Fast Solar Energy Facts
Worldwide photovoltaic installations increased by 1,744 MW in 2006, up from
1,460 MW installed during the previous year. In 1985, annual solar installation
demand was only 21 Megawatts, ... |

Solar cell operation
solar cells convert light energy into electrical energy either indirectly by first converting it into heat, or through a direct process known as the photovoltaic effect. The most common types of solar cells are based on the
photovoltaic effect, which occurs when light falling on a two-layer semiconductor material produces a potential difference, or voltage, between the
two layers |
